摘要

Abstract

According to the chemical bonds strength between inorganic/organic components of hybrid materials, the hybrid materials can be divided into class I (the components are linked via hydrogen bonds or Van der Waals forces) and class II (linked via covalent bonds). The class II hybrid materials draw more attentions because of their many advantages containing higher thermal stability,luminescent intensity,uniformity and so on. Two classes' hybrid materials prepared by sol-gel method were reviewed. Sol-gel method has some advantages over other preparation methods in lower reaction temperature,higher uniformity and purity,and this method can be widely used in preparation of hybrid materials.
